Ramp is a financial platform founded in 2019 and headquartered in New York, specializing in the modernization and automation of corporate finance. With over 1,600 employees, the fintech company offers a comprehensive all-in-one solution for businesses of all sizes – from startups to global enterprises. The platform consolidates various financial functions that are traditionally handled across separate systems. These include the issuance of global corporate credit cards, automated expense management, bill pay (Accounts Payable), travel management, as well as procurement processes and vendor management. A key advantage of Ramp is the seamless integration of accounting automation and real-time analytics, which minimizes manual processes and delivers significant time and cost savings. The platform supports payments in over 195 countries and is used by more than 50,000 customers worldwide. By leveraging AI-powered receipt capture and automated workflows, Ramp helps companies streamline their financial processes and ensure compliance with internal policies.

Customers predominantly describe Ramp as a modern, highly user-friendly expense management solution with strong automation around corporate credit cards, expenses, and invoices. The ease of use, the ability to control expenses granularly, real-time transparency, and the pricing model—which is often perceived as fair, cost-oriented, or even savings-oriented—are particularly praised. Weaknesses are occasionally noted in specific integration or feature requests, as well as occasional service and support issues, but overall, the sentiment is clearly positive. Ramp is especially suitable for fast-growing startups, scale-ups, and mid-sized companies looking to centralize, automate, and control their corporate spending in real time, and less so for very small companies with very simple requirements.
